Le PaaS (Platform as a Service) joue un rôle crucial dans la mise en œuvre de l'architecture microservices et la conteneurisation, deux tendances majeures dans le développement d'applications modernes en Suisse et dans le monde. Voici comment le PaaS soutient ces approches :
1. Simplification du déploiement et de la gestion
Le PaaS fournit une plateforme pré-configurée qui simplifie considérablement le déploiement et la gestion des microservices et des conteneurs. Les développeurs suisses peuvent se concentrer sur le code plutôt que sur l'infrastructure sous-jacente.
2. Orchestration des conteneurs
De nombreuses solutions PaaS intègrent des outils d'orchestration de conteneurs comme Kubernetes, facilitant la gestion, le déploiement et la mise à l'échelle des applications conteneurisées. Cela est particulièrement important pour les entreprises suisses qui cherchent à optimiser leurs ressources IT.
3. Scalabilité automatique
Le PaaS offre généralement des fonctionnalités de mise à l'échelle automatique, essentielles pour les architectures microservices. Cela permet aux applications de s'adapter rapidement à la demande, un avantage considérable pour les entreprises suisses opérant dans des secteurs comme la finance ou la pharma, où la réactivité est cruciale.
4. Intégration et livraison continues (CI/CD)
Les plateformes PaaS facilitent souvent l'intégration des pipelines CI/CD, permettant aux équipes de développement suisses de mettre à jour et de déployer rapidement et fréquemment leurs microservices.
5. Gestion des services
Le PaaS simplifie la gestion des services associés aux microservices, tels que les bases de données, les caches et les files d'attente de messages. Cela est particulièrement utile dans le contexte suisse, où la gestion efficace des données est primordiale en raison des réglementations strictes sur la protection des données.
6. Portabilité et flexibilité
La conteneurisation favorise la portabilité des applications, permettant aux entreprises suisses de déplacer facilement leurs services entre différents environnements ou fournisseurs de cloud, réduisant ainsi le risque de dépendance à un seul fournisseur.
7. Conformité et sécurité
De nombreuses solutions PaaS offrent des fonctionnalités de sécurité et de conformité intégrées, ce qui est crucial pour les entreprises suisses soumises à des réglementations strictes comme la GDPR ou la FINMA.
Avantage | Impact pour les entreprises suisses |
Déploiement simplifié | Accélération du time-to-market |
Scalabilité automatique | Optimisation des coûts et des ressources |
Intégration CI/CD | Innovation plus rapide et compétitivité accrue |
Gestion des données | Conformité aux réglementations suisses sur la protection des données |
Portabilité | Flexibilité et réduction des risques liés aux fournisseurs |
En conclusion, le PaaS est un facilitateur clé pour l'adoption de l'architecture microservices et de la conteneurisation en Suisse. Il permet aux entreprises de moderniser leurs applications tout en répondant aux exigences spécifiques du marché suisse en termes de performance, de sécurité et de conformité réglementaire. Les experts en PaaS et les consultants PaaS en Suisse jouent un rôle crucial en aidant les organisations à tirer le meilleur parti de ces technologies pour rester compétitives sur le marché mondial.